Interview with Choreographer and Performer Margaret Grenier
Flicker, directed by choreographer and performer Margaret Grenier, is a multi-media dance piece performed by Vancouver-based Indigenous dance company, Dancers of Damelahamid of the Gitxsan Nation. The Gitxsan, “people of the river of mists”, are part of the coastal group of cultures renowned for their history of masked dance. Here,...
